Output 26a33760c1439d5affdc9250e9d1df35c74ef66b71aaf230b410c8046d8fb9b4:19

value
30594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b418e1f6e7ffe0e72a0a69f796e51938482adc0 OP_EQUAL
address
3EPLP4VcEE4WyGj4NMp1FdxepqTtPR8sCg
transaction
26a33760c1439d5affdc9250e9d1df35c74ef66b71aaf230b410c8046d8fb9b4
spent
true